2012 TWD to TJS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the TWD to TJS ex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on July 11, valuing the pair at 0.1652.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on July 24, dropping to 0.1520.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0132 TJS.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.1585 to the December average rate of 0.1640, the exchange rate registered a net change of 3.49%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 0.1652 was up 0.67% compared to the 2011 peak of 0.1641,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.1607 0.1571 0.1585
February 0.1618 0.1605 0.1610
March 0.1617 0.1607 0.1612
April 0.1631 0.1609 0.1615
May 0.1632 0.1597 0.1615
June 0.1598 0.1587 0.1593
July 0.1652 0.1520 0.1583
August 0.1533 0.1526 0.1530
September 0.1626 0.1532 0.1574
October 0.1634 0.1568 0.1627
November 0.1643 0.1628 0.1636
December 0.1642 0.1637 0.1640
